How they compare
Kenya currently reports 0.0589 units per person against 0.0261 units per person in Post-demographic dividend, a difference of 0.0328 units per person.
That makes Kenya's figure about 2.3 times Post-demographic dividend's.
Across all 66 years both countries report, Kenya has been ahead every year.
Kenya ranks 37th and Post-demographic dividend ranks 40th of 218 countries.
Kenya has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Kenya | Post-demographic dividend |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 0.0614 units per person | 0.0438 units per person | 0.0176 units per person | Kenya |
| 1970s | 0.0691 units per person | 0.0423 units per person | 0.0269 units per person | Kenya |
| 1980s | 0.0698 units per person | 0.0366 units per person | 0.0331 units per person | Kenya |
| 1990s | 0.0689 units per person | 0.0322 units per person | 0.0367 units per person | Kenya |
| 2000s | 0.0647 units per person | 0.0296 units per person | 0.0351 units per person | Kenya |
| 2010s | 0.063 units per person | 0.0269 units per person | 0.0362 units per person | Kenya |
| 2020s | 0.0619 units per person | 0.0267 units per person | 0.0353 units per person | Kenya |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
